2 The word “Monsoon” The word "monsoon" is derived from the Arabic word "mausim" which means season. Ancient traders sailing in the Indian Ocean and adjoining Arabian Sea used it to describe a system of alternating winds which blow persistently from the northeast during the northern winter and from the opposite direction, the southwest, during the northern summer. Thus, the term monsoon actually refers solely to a seasonal wind shift, and not to precipitation

5 DEFINITION Prevailing wind direction shifts by at least 120º betwen January and July Average frequency of prevailing directions in January and July exceeds 40%

6 The Monsoon Makers 1) Seasonal Heating 2) Moisture Processes 3) The Earth’s Rotation

7 The Monsoon Makers: 1) Seasonal Heating Seasonal contrasts in land surface temperatures produce atmospheric pressure changes. ~ 30C ~ 86F

9 The Monsoon Makers 1) Seasonal Heating As a result, there are major seasonal wind reversals referred to as “the monsoons”

10 The Monsoon Makers 2) Moisture Processes http://www.geo.arizona.edu/Antevs/ecol438/monsoon.gif Energy released in the form of latent heat of condensation raises summer land-ocean pressure differences to a point higher than they would be in the absence of moisture in the atmosphere. 11 The Monsoon Makers 3) The Earth’s Rotation The air in monsoon currents moves in curved paths Winds change direction as they cross the equator because of changes in the Coriolis Force Equator Fc Fc

12 The Monsoon Makers 1) Seasonal Heating 2) Moisture Processes 3) The Earth’s Rotation Moiture releases energy (latent heat) that intensifies the monsoon Seasonal temperature and pressure changes produce seasonal wind reversals Air moves in curved paths and winds change direction as they cross the equator

14 Variability of the Monsoons There is considerable variability in the onset, duration and magnitude of the monsoons Mechanisms: Internal Dynamics Internal Dynamics = variations in the atmospheric circulation (e.g. travelling disturbances, thermal and orographic forcing, and tropical-extratropical interactions) Boundary Forcing Boundary Forcing = changes in surface conditions (e.g. extent of snow cover, soil moisture, and sea surface temperature)  energy balance  geographical distribution of heat and moisture Internal Dynamics + Boundary Forcing Internal Dynamics + Boundary Forcing = Monsoon variations
